Here’s the list of supplies you’ll need to make you own set of wooden spool ornaments:
- Wooden Spools
- Wooden Stars
- Ribbon – Seven Assorted Colors and Patterns OPTION 1 or OPTION 2
- Dixie Belle Moonshine Metallics in Gold Digger
- Hot Glue Gun
- Hot Glue Sticks
- Paintbrush
- Scissors
- Twine, Natural – 10” lengths
NOTE: You could easily make larger ornaments by working with larger spools and ribbon. Or, use fabric scraps instead of ribbon and add some texture with pinking shears like the ones found HERE.
To begin, gather all of your supplies. Attach ribbon pieces to wooden spool using glue gun and glue sticks. Each tree requires seven spools, six Christmas patterns and one brown pattern.
Paint wooden stars with metallic gold paint. Let dry and apply a second coat, if necessary.
Assemble the spool tree by gluing together three spools to create the base. Add two spools on the second row and then one spool at the top in a pyramid shape. Attach the tree trunk spool at the bottom center.
To finish, knot a ten-inch section of twine into a loop and glue to top spool. Attach the star to the twine with glue gun and glue sticks.
